We are thrilled to share monumental news! After years of relentless effort, Gluwa has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) to officially onboard as a Partner Agent and help drive the increased adoption of Nigeria’s CBDC, also known as eNaira.

The partnership’s core objective is to harness the power of blockchain technology to enhance financial inclusion, improve eNaira functionality, and foster financial innovation.

By becoming the CBN’s official Partner Agent, Gluwa will integrate its Credal blockchain innovation directly with Nigeria’s CBDC (eNaira), as a first step towards deepened collaboration. Gluwa sets its high ambitions of onboarding millions of Nigerians by implementing its Credal technology to build credit reputations for eNaira users as a valuable new way to drive the adoption of the CBDC. Credal’s integration will also enable easier loan origination, tracking, settlement, and credit scoring for local fintech lenders.

Additionally, the partnership between Gluwa and the CBN will focus on:

  • Simplifying Fintech Lending — Enabling fintech lenders to expedite the loan origination process by facilitating direct eNaira transfers to customers, thereby enhancing the speed and efficiency of services provided.
  • Authenticating Transactions — Establishing the eNaira as the definitive record for all loan transactions conducted by fintech partners, ensuring accuracy and transparency in financial operations and credit scoring.
  • User Authentication — Implementing a robust authentication mechanism utilizing asymmetric encryption with private/public keys, to offer users a secure, private, and regulatory-compliant way of accessing financial services.

Why Credal is Significant

Our goal with Credal was to tackle a significant challenge: credit-related data being exclusively confined within traditional banking systems, leaving the unbanked with no means to establish credit profiles.

Adding to this limitation, existing credit profiles are inherently domestic and lack accessibility beyond a country’s borders. Recognizing the critical role a credit profile plays in fostering financial independence, we believe that its scope should extend beyond national boundaries.

Credal unlocked these boundaries with the establishment of a public blockchain that easily integrated with the processes of fintech lenders, in which the RWA-focused network has recorded over 4.27 million loan transactions valued at $80 million (USD) and has serviced over 337,000 users. By having pseudo-anonymous credit profiles, the clients of fintech lenders qualified for participation in global investment pools, fostering financial inclusivity and creating opportunities for previously underserved individuals.
